Charitable objects
READING ROOM AND CLUB FOR THE USE O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E RESPECTIVE PARISHES OF REEPHAM KERDISTON HACKFORD NEXT REEPHAM AND WHITWELL IN THE COUNTY OF NORFOLK AND OTHER ADJOINING PARISHES AND OTHERWISE F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E SAID PARISHES AS DETAILED IN THE TRUST DEED.
